MACD Stocks Indicator Crossover Stocks Signals

MACD Center line crossovers generate stock trading signals using the center line mark. The sentiment of the stock trading market can be confirmed using the MACD center line crossovers. MACD stocks crossover above the center line mark generates bullish stock trading market sentiment while crossover below the center line generates bearish stocks market sentiment.

  • When the Fast line crosses below the MACD Line (not center mark) it shows stocks market momentum is slowing - this is not a reversal stocks signal or a sell signal, wait for center mark crossover.
  • When the Fast line crosses above the MACD Line (not center mark) it shows the stocks market momentum is slowing - this is not a reversal stocks signal or a buy signal, wait for center mark crossover.
  • The Center-Line crossover stocks signals will be the best trading signals for confirming buy and sell signals.

Using the Stocks Trading chart in the stocks example illustrated and explained below, when MACD fast line crossed below the zero center mark, the sell signal was confirmed and the stocks market sentiment changed to bearish - downwards stock trend.

Also in the stocks example illustrated and explained below when MACD fast line later crosses above zero center mark, a buy signal was generated and the stocks market sentiment changed to bullish - upwards stock trend.

Oscillation of the MACD Stocks Indicator

The MACD Stocks indicator is an oscillator indicator that moves up and down around a zero center line mark. The center-line is the neutral measurement, values above zero will indicate bullish stock trading market stocks trend while values below indicate bearish stock trend.

The MACD indicator is also used to indicate overbought and oversold levels. When the MACD reaches overextended levels, then a stocks instrument is overbought or oversold. However, in a strong upward trending stocks market stocks prices will stay overbought in this case it's better to buy.

Also in a strong down stock trending stock trading market its better to sell, because stocks prices will stay in the oversold region for a long time.

Overbought conditions occur above the zero line while oversold conditions occur way below the zero mark.
